Practical Stereo Reverberation for Studio Recording

The need for achieving stereophonic reverberation in studio recording is discussed. Previous work reported in the literature is reviewed, methods and techniques applicable to recording facilities are considered, and the development and testing of an experimental model are detailed. Tests of the final model and sample recordings are discussed.
